THE Dodgers clobbered the Marlins, 16-3, in a 2023 SBL Masters League game at the Francisco “Tan Ko” Palacios Baseball Field on Wednesday.
The Dodgers had an explosive start as the bases quickly filled after James Benavente and Derek Aguon connected a single each and slipped past home bases due to defensive errors. Three more runs were then added, highlighted by Richard Quitugua’s two-RBI double to give the Dodgers the lead, 5-0.
The Marlins replied with a run contributed by Cartfield Sablan who hit an RBI single, but the Dodgers retaliated with seven runs in the top of the second inning as Bruce Norita and Ed Manibusan contributed two RBIs each to make it 12-1.
The Marlins continued to put up a fight and added a total of two runs in the bottom of the second and third innings, but the Dodgers also kept the fuel burning on their end, scoring three runs in the third and one more in the fourth for a commanding lead, 16-3.
With the Marlins failing to score in the next two innings, the game ended in the fifth and the Dodgers claimed their fifth win.
